Literature summary for 2.4.2.30 extracted from

  • Infante, J.; Sanchez-Juan, P.; Mateo, I.; Rodriguez-Rodriguez, E.; Sanchez-Quintana, C.; Llorca, J.; Fontalba, A.; Terrazas, J.; Oterino, A.; Berciano, J.; Combarros, O.
    Poly (ADP-ribose) polymerase-1 (PARP-1) genetic variants are protective against Parkinsons disease (2007), J. Neurol. Sci., 256, 68-70.
